The IFC is comprised of member organizations of the North American Interfraternity Council (NIC). Founded in 1909, the North-American Interfraternity Conference is the trade association representing 75 International and National Men’s Fraternities. The NIC serves to advocate the needs of its member fraternities through enrichment of the fraternity experience; advancement and growth of the fraternity community; and enhancement of the educational mission of the host institutions. The NIC is also committed to enhancing the benefits of fraternity membership. The IFC on campus is the governing board for the fraternities on campus providing leadership and programming opportunities to its member organizations. |
